diff options
Diffstat (limited to 'users/models')
-rw-r--r-- | users/models/follow.py |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/users/models/follow.py b/users/models/follow.py index d2ee493..e741c56 100644 --- a/users/models/follow.py +++ b/users/models/follow.py @@ -24,6 +24,10 @@ class FollowStates(StateGraph): undone.transitions_to(undone_remotely) @classmethod + def group_active(cls): + return [cls.unrequested, cls.local_requested, cls.accepted] + + @classmethod async def handle_unrequested(cls, instance: "Follow"): """ Follows that are unrequested need us to deliver the Follow object |